Description

(Tetra-T-Butylphthalocyaninato)Lead(II) is a metallophthalocyanine complex where lead(II) is coordinated within a tetra-t-butyl substituted phthalocyanine macrocycle. This compound is valued for its unique photophysical and electrochemical properties derived from its specific molecular architecture. It is primarily utilized in advanced material science and research sectors, including the development of organic semiconductors, photoconductors, and specialized catalysts.

Application

  • Organic Semiconductor Research: A key component in the study and fabrication of n-type or p-type organic thin-film transistors (OTFTs) due to its charge transport characteristics.
  • Photoconductive Materials: Used in the development of xerographic photoreceptors and other light-sensitive devices for imaging technologies.
  • Catalysis: Investigated as a potential catalyst or catalyst precursor for specialized organic transformations and oxidation reactions.
  • Non-Linear Optics (NLO): Serves as a material of interest for research into third-order optical non-linearity and optical limiting applications.
  • Chemical Sensing: Explored for use in the sensitive layers of chemiresistive or optical sensors for detecting specific gases or vapors.
  • Dye and Pigment Intermediate: Acts as a precursor for the synthesis of novel, stable pigments with unique coloristic properties.

Basic Information

Item Details
Product Name (Tetra-T-Butylphthalocyaninato)Lead(II)
CAS No. 158335-62-7
Molecular Formula C48H48N8Pb
Molecular Weight 1000.16 g/mol
Synonyms Lead(II) tetra-tert-butylphthalocyanine; Tetra-tert-butylphthalocyanine lead complex; TBPC-Pb; Phthalocyanine lead derivative; 2,9,16,23-Tetra-tert-butylphthalocyaninato lead; 29H,31H-Phthalocyanine, lead complex with 2,9,16,23-tetra-tert-butyl derivative; Lead tetra-t-butylphthalocyanine

Storage

Preserve in a tightly closed container, protected from light. Store under an inert atmosphere (e.g., nitrogen or argon) at room temperature (15-25°C) in a cool, dry, and well-ventilated place. Keep away from strong oxidizing agents.

Specification

Item Specification
Appearance Dark blue to purple solid
Identification (IR) Conforms to structure
Purity (HPLC) ≥ 95% (Area %)
Lead Content (ICP-OES) 20.0 - 21.5 %
Solubility Soluble in common organic solvents (e.g., DCM, THF, Toluene)
